Election Day is almost here â€” but it ain't over just yet.

Floridians head to the polls tomorrow to elect America's next president and choose officials at the local, state, and federal levels. Voters will also decide the fate of six state constitutional amendments, including initiatives that would guarantee abortion access and recreational marijuana.

While registered voters could vote at any early voting site during the early voting period, they must go to their assigned precinct on Election Day (AKA Tuesday, November 5). Polls will be open from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m.

Below, find out how to find your polling place in South Florida.

Miami-Dade County

Here's a link to the Miami-Dade County voter information tool.

Enter your first and last name and your date of birth to find your voting precinct number and Election Day polling location.

Broward County

Here's a link to Broward County's precinct finder. Enter your home address to find your voting precinct number and Election Day polling location.

Palm Beach County

Here's a link to Palm Beach County's precinct finder.

Enter your home address to find your voting precinct number and Election Day polling location.
